We are working with a leading entrepreneurial ESG Consultancy who have been involved with many innovative and leading projects providing a range of services to meet client needs from technical advice to environmental assessments and due diligence.
Our client has been established since 2018 and has a strong team of ESG specialists who work closely with their clients providing advice and support based from funky offices in central London.
The role involves being part of a multi-disciplinary team, shaping the direction and contributing to the success of their ESG practice. Responsibilities include overseeing numerous projects in a client-facing role, acting as the Project Manager to large scale projects and working directly with a range of stakeholders including developers and lenders.
Tasks will include:
- Writing technical reports, client presentations and insight materials.
- Working closely with clients to develop effective business relationships and deliver a transparent, reputable service.
- Providing strategic advice and direction to steer clients and help to implement strategy to meet their business objectives and become industry leaders.
- Driving internal business growth and identifying opportunities to develop service lines.
- Acting as a mentor and subject matter expert within the ESG practice to support junior team members.
- Following the ESG evolution to understand and drive new methodology and solutions for emerging sustainability challenges.
Skills & Experience:
- Degree in either Environmental Science, Sustainability, Geography, Economics or related subject.
- Minimum of 7 yearsβ experience within ESG, ideally from a consultancy or in-house setting.
- Solid understanding of ESG frameworks, ESG reporting standards and methodologies.
- Previous project management experience, having led complex projects, strategy development, risk assessments and stakeholder engagement.
- Ability to tailor solutions and present practical recommendations to clients.
- Able to work with large data sets, analyse metrics to find actionable resolutions to problems.
- Previously led project teams and managed activities to meet project goals and deadlines.
- Business development activities including proposal preparation and pitching experience.
